Tissue specificity:Expressed specifically in the musculoskeletal system (skeletal muscle and tendon). Highly expressed during bone regeneration, especially during the early phases (post fracure days 3 and 5). Expression within the fracture callus is localized in osteoprogenitor cells of the periosteum, proliferating chondrocytes, and young active osteoblasts. 1

Developmental stage:Abundantly expressed in developing embryos, especially in mesenchymal condensations of limbs, vertebral perichondrium and mesenchymal cells of the intervertebral disks. 1
